Shared hosting is often a practical starting point for new website owners due to its affordability and simplicity. It allows multiple websites to share the same server resources, making it suitable for small projects or startups. However, as traffic increases and your site requires more resources, shared hosting may show performance, reliability, and security limitations.
Understanding when to transition from shared hosting can help support sustained growth. This guide explores the limitations of shared environments, identifies potential signs that it may be time to upgrade, and offers strategies that may help ensure a smoother migration. With proper planning, you can often scale more confidently while working to maintain site performance.
The bar graph illustrates common challenges high-traffic websites may face on shared hosting. Among the frequently reported issues are resource contention, performance bottlenecks, and downtime during traffic spikes. These challenges often stem from the shared nature of server resources, which typically can't scale with growing demand. Security considerations, limited customization options, and scalability constraints can impact performance and reliability. As your site grows, these issues may intensify, suggesting that shared hosting works best for smaller, lower-traffic environments. Upgrading to VPS, managed, or cloud hosting can be worth considering for business continuity and long-term scalability.
Shared hosting is a type of web hosting in which multiple websites are hosted on a single physical server and share the same pool of resources, such as CPU, RAM, and bandwidth. Its widespread popularity stems mainly from its affordability and simplicity, making it an attractive choice for individuals, startups, and small businesses just entering the online space. With user-friendly control panels and one-click installations for popular platforms like WordPress, shared hosting can remove much of the technical burden for beginners.
Another reason shared hosting appeals to many is the relatively low monthly cost compared to more advanced options like VPS or dedicated hosting. Hosting providers typically manage the server environment, so users don't usually worry about software updates or system maintenance. However, while this setup can be cost-effective and straightforward, it's helpful to recognize that resource limitations and potential performance bottlenecks often make shared hosting better suited for lower-traffic sites than growing businesses with demanding needs.
In a shared hosting environment, your website shares server resources like CPU, memory, and bandwidth with many other sites. This setup helps keep costs low but comes with certain limitations. Since resources are distributed among multiple accounts, your site's performance may be affected if another site on the same server experiences a traffic spike or consumes significant resources. Even moderate usage from multiple sites can sometimes slow down your site's loading time and responsiveness.
Most hosting providers set resource limits per account to help prevent abuse and maintain fair usage. These limitations can help maintain server stability but may reduce flexibility and scalability for growing sites. As your traffic increases or you begin using more plugins, themes, or scripts, you may encounter those limits more frequently, potentially leading to slowdowns or service notifications.
While shared hosting can serve its purpose for smaller websites, it may begin to show limitations as traffic grows. Higher-traffic websites often require more consistent performance and resource availability, which can be challenging to guarantee in a shared environment. Because all users draw from the same pool of server resources, a sudden spike in traffic on one site can potentially affect the performance of others, sometimes causing slower load times, temporary outages, or other issues.
Moreover, shared hosting often restricts access to advanced settings, making optimizing for performance or applying custom security configurations difficult. These limitations can potentially affect everything from user experience to search engine optimization. For businesses that depend on uptime, speed, and flexibility, staying on shared hosting longer than necessary may result in missed opportunities and recurring technical challenges.
The limitations of shared hosting can potentially impact your business as it grows. Slower page load speeds or occasional downtime may frustrate users, potentially leading to abandoned carts, reduced sales, and decreased customer confidence. Industry studies suggest that even a few seconds of delay can affect conversions in competitive digital environments. If your website is strategically important, shared hosting's potential inconsistencies may become more of a liability than an asset.
Beyond performance, shared hosting may influence your brand's reputation and online visibility. Search engines often favor fast, stable websites in their rankings. A website that frequently loads slowly or experiences reliability issues could result in lower search performance, fewer organic visitors, and reduced competitive positioning. Security considerations also increase, as vulnerabilities on one site in a shared environment could affect others.
Monitoring your website's performance on shared hosting can be valuable, especially as traffic begins to grow. Because resources are shared, your site may experience slowdowns or outages due to activity on other sites hosted on the same server. Using performance monitoring tools may help you avoid problems by identifying bottlenecks, resource usage spikes, or downtime before they can affect users.
Several tools can track different aspects of your website's performance. From real-time uptime tracking to detailed load time analysis and server health reports, these tools can help you make more informed decisions about when to optimize or upgrade your hosting plan.
GTmetrix is a website performance analysis tool that can help you understand how your site loads and identify potential slowdowns. It provides insights that may help optimize speed and improve user experience.
Key Features:
Pingdom is a website monitoring tool that tracks uptime, response times, and user interactions. It can help website owners detect issues and work to improve site performance through detailed historical data and alerts.
Key Features:
WP Server Stats is a lightweight WordPress plugin that provides server performance data in your dashboard. It can help you monitor resource usage and identify potential performance issues.
Key Features:
UptimeRobot is a website monitoring tool that tracks your site's availability and performance. It can alert you when your site goes down or experiences slow response times, potentially helping you maintain uptime and user confidence.
Key Features:
New Relic is a comprehensive observability platform offering advanced server and application performance monitoring. It can help developers and IT teams diagnose backend issues, optimize resource usage, and work toward system reliability at scale.
Key Features:
Shared hosting can become a performance bottleneck as your website attracts more visitors and handles more transactions. Consider an upgrade if you notice slower page loads, occasional downtime, or limitations on installing desired plugins. Shared servers are typically designed for lower-traffic sites, and pushing beyond those limits can sometimes affect your site's reliability, user experience, and customer confidence.
Hosting providers often issue notifications about resource usage as an early signal that your site may be outgrowing its current plan. This can be particularly important for businesses that depend on uptime for revenue or experience seasonal spikes in traffic. Transitioning to a more scalable solution may help your site grow without significant disruption and deliver consistent performance.
Shared hosting can work well during the early stages of your website, but as your traffic and technical requirements grow, you may start seeing signs that it's no longer meeting your needs. When your website frequently slows down or experiences consistent issues during peak hours, you may have reached the practical limits of what shared hosting can support. These issues can potentially frustrate visitors, reduce conversions, and affect your search engine rankings.
Upgrading at the right time may help prevent lost opportunities and support your business's growth. If your website is becoming mission-critical, has increasing visitor numbers, or requires custom server configurations, it might be worth considering more scalable options like VPS, managed hosting, or cloud hosting. Staying on shared hosting longer than necessary could ultimately cost more in missed opportunities than investing in a more capable plan.
When your website starts approaching the limitations of shared hosting, upgrading to a more capable hosting environment may become worthwhile. Several alternatives can offer improved performance, security, and scalability. These options typically provide dedicated resources and greater control, potentially helping your website handle higher traffic volumes and complex applications with fewer disruptions. Choosing the right alternative often depends on your needs, budget, and technical comfort level.
Each alternative to shared hosting comes with its own characteristics. VPS hosting can offer more control and dedicated virtual resources. Managed hosting may remove the burden of server maintenance. Dedicated hosting provides complete access to all server resources, while cloud hosting can offer flexibility and scalability for fast-growing websites or businesses with variable traffic patterns.
VPS (Virtual Private Server) hosting represents a step up from shared hosting in terms of performance, control, and reliability. While shared hosting means your site shares resources with many others, VPS provides a private partition featuring dedicated CPU, RAM, and storage, isolated from other websites. This isolation helps ensure that traffic spikes on other sites won't affect your performance, potentially making VPS more suitable for growing websites or eCommerce platforms.
In addition to potentially better performance, VPS hosting allows for deeper customization. You can often install your software, configure server settings, and run more demanding applications without worrying about shared restrictions. It's also typically more secure, potentially reducing the risk of cross-site vulnerabilities common in shared environments. For businesses expecting consistent traffic growth, VPS may provide a more stable, scalable environment that can grow with your needs.
Alojamiento administrado can be a practical solution for higher-traffic websites because it removes much of the technical burden of server management while potentially delivering improved performance, uptime, and security. With managed hosting, your provider typically handles tasks like server monitoring, updates, backups, and security protection, allowing you to focus more on growing your business. This type of hosting may be particularly beneficial for site owners who lack the time or expertise to maintain complex infrastructure.
For higher-traffic sites, managed hosting can help ensure your server remains stable under pressure and scales more easily when demand increases. Hosting providers typically include expert-level support and performance optimization tools that may help your site stay fast and reliable, even during peak periods. Whether running an online store, a media platform, or a membership site, managed hosting can offer the support and resources that may help maintain a smoother user experience.
Migrating from shared hosting to a more advanced solution requires careful planning to help avoid data loss, service interruptions, or search ranking issues. The process typically begins by creating a complete website backup, including files, databases, emails, and configurations. Once you've selected your new hosting environment, whether VPS, cloud, or managed hosting, you should usually install your website in a staging area and test it thoroughly before going live.
A successful migration also typically includes DNS updates, downtime communication, and performance monitoring after launch. Notifying users of potential brief outages and having a rollback plan can help minimize impact. With proper planning and execution, the migration process can often be smooth and may result in improved website speed, security, and uptime.
Although shared hosting has limitations, several ways exist to optimize your site's performance and security while staying within those constraints. Implementing optimization practices may help extend the value of your hosting plan, improve speed, and reduce resource usage. These techniques can be beneficial if you're not ready to upgrade yet but want to maintain a more stable user experience.
These proactive steps, from website optimization to security precautions, may help minimize downtime and improve load times. Routine maintenance, efficient website design, and close monitoring of your site's performance can often go a long way in keeping your site responsive and reliable, despite being in a shared environment.
Preparing your shared hosting environment ahead of time can be valuable if you expect a sudden influx of visitors, whether from a flash sale, viral post, or email campaign. Shared hosting plans typically aren't built to handle large, unpredictable spikes in traffic, so that proactive optimization may be your best defense. Without preparation, your site risks slowing down or becoming temporarily unavailable during critical moments.
Focus on reducing strain on server resources to help keep your site more stable under pressure. Preloading content, minimizing background tasks, and implementing caching plugins can often make a notable difference. You might also consider coordinating with your hosting provider to explore any temporary upgrades or traffic-handling features they may offer.
Many website owners wonder how far they can extend shared hosting's capabilities. While it can be a cost-effective option for smaller sites, understanding its limitations is helpful. Most shared hosting plans typically can't reliably support thousands of daily visitors or frequent spikes in traffic. As your audience grows, performance issues and server limitations often become more apparent, sometimes at inconvenient times.
Understanding what's realistic with shared hosting can help you plan your next steps. Optimization may help you stay on shared plans longer, but eventually, upgrading often becomes necessary. Fortunately, moving to VPS or managed hosting has become more accessible, especially with beginner-friendly providers.
Shared hosting can work well in the early stages of your website journey, but it may become limiting once your traffic, content, and user demands grow. If you're experiencing frequent slow page loads, limited server control, or repeated downtime notifications, these can be signals that your hosting environment may no longer align with your business goals. Continuing shared hosting beyond its practical limits might hinder growth, reduce conversions, and affect your brand's reliability, particularly during peak times.
To help maintain performance and scalability, transitioning to a more advanced hosting environment can be worth considering. Whether you need more control via VPS, simplicity through managed hosting, or the flexibility of cloud infrastructure, choosing the right provider and solution can make a significant difference.
When evaluating hosting options, consider providers that offer professional hosting solutions tailored for growing and higher-traffic websites. Look for seamless migrations, proactive security measures, and expert support to help eliminate hosting bottlenecks and provide your site with faster load times, better uptime, and scalable infrastructure. The goal is finding a hosting solution that supports your growth rather than limiting it, allowing you to focus on what matters most: serving your audience and growing your business.